BACKGROUND: The use of simulation has the potential to accelerate the learning curves and increase the efficiency of surgeons. However, there is currently a scarcity in models dedicated to skull base surgical approaches. Thus, the objective of this study was to develop a cost-effective mixed reality system consisting of an ultrarealistic physical model and augmented reality and evaluate its use in training surgeons on the retrosigmoid approach. METHODS: The virtual models were developed from images of patients with vestibular schwannoma. The tumor was mirrored to allow bilateral approaches and the model has drawers for repositioning structures, allowing reuse of the material and cost reduction. Pre and posttest assessments were applied to 10 residents and young neurosurgeons, divided into control and test groups. Only the control group was exposed to the model. The difference in scores obtained by participants before and after exposure to the models was considered for analysis and participants in the control group answered self-satisfaction questionnaires. RESULTS: The mean differences were 4.80 in the control group (95% credibility intervals=1.08-9.79) and 5.43 in the test group (95% credibility intervals=1.67-8.20). The average score of the self-satisfaction questionnaires was 24.0 (23-25). CONCLUSIONS: The ultrarealistic model efficiently allowed retromastoid access to the cerebellopontine angle. A tendency toward greater gains in performance in the group exposed to the model was verified. Scores from the self-satisfaction questionnaires demonstrated that participants considered the model relevant for neurosurgical training and increased confidence among surgeons.

Abstract Choroid plexus papillomas (CPPs) are rare benign neoplasms which are particularly uncommon in the posterior fossa in children. We herein present a case series of five patients treated at a tertiary care hospital. A comprehensive literature review was also carried out. The patients treated at the tertiary care hospital were aged between 4 and 16 years. Gross total resection (GTR) was initially achieved in two patients. All patients showed clinical improvement. Moreover, 27 articles published between 1975 and 2021 were selected for the literature review, totaling 46 patients; with the 5 patients previously described, the total sample was composed of 51 cases, With a mean age was 8.2 years. The lesions were located either in the fourth ventricle (65.3%) or the cerebellopontine angle (34.7%). Hydrocephalus was present preoperatively in 66.7% of the patients, and a permanent shunt was required in 31.6% of the cases. The GTR procedure was feasible in 64.5%, and 93.8% showed clinical improvement. For CPPs, GTR is the gold standard treatment and should be attempted whenever feasible, especially because the role of the adjuvant treatment remains controversial. Neuromonitoring is a valuable tool to achieve maximal safe resection. Hydrocephalus is common and must be recognized and promptly treated. Most patients will need a permanent shunt. Though there is still controversy on its efficacy, endoscopic third ventriculostomy is a safe procedure, and was the authors' first choice to treat hydrocephalus.

Cavernous malformations are vascular malformations that can occur anywhere in the central nervous system (CNS). Giant cavernous malformations (GCM) are extremely rare in adults, especially in the posterior fossa. Herein, we described a 48-year-old male who presented with vertigo and postural instability for three months. Neuroimaging revealed a 131.15 cm3 heterogeneous midline upper cerebellar lesion. After a suboccipital craniotomy, a gross total resection (GTR) was accomplished. Histopathologic examination revealed a huge cavernous malformation. Only 27 GCM adult cases were reported in the English-based literature. Only two patients had cerebellar lesions and, to the best of our knowledge, this is the first case of cerebellar vermis GCM. We concluded that cerebellar GCM (CGCM) in adults are exceedingly rare and indolent lesions. These lesions can radiologically and clinically mimic neoplastic lesions that have to be considered in the differential diagnosis. GTR is the mainstay of treatment and, whenever possible, should be attempted.

OBJECTIVES: Coronavirus disease (COVID-19) is a potentially severe respiratory illness that has threatened humanity globally. The pediatric neurosurgery practice differs from that of adults in that it treats children in various stages of physical and psychological development and contemplates diseases that do not exist in other areas. The aim of this study was to identify the level of knowledge and readiness of the healthcare providers, as well as to evaluate new preventive practices that have been introduced, psychological concerns, and the impact of the COVID-19 pandemic on pediatric neurosurgical units in Brazil. METHODS: Pediatric neurosurgeons were given an online questionnaire developed by the Brazilian Society of Pediatric Neurosurgery to evaluate the impact of the COVID-19 pandemic on their clinical practice. RESULTS: Of a cohort of 110 active members of the Brazilian Society of Pediatric Neurosurgery, 76 completed the survey (69%). Ninety-six percent were aware of the correct use of and indication for the types of personal protective equipment in clinical and surgical practices, but only 73.7% of them had unrestricted access to this equipment. Ninety-eight percent of participants agreed or strongly agreed that the pandemic had affected their pediatric neurosurgical practice. The COVID-19 pandemic interfered with outpatient care in 88% of the centers, it affected neurosurgical activity in 90.7%, and it led to the cancellation of elective neurosurgical procedures in 57.3%. Concerning the impact of COVID-19 on surgical activity, 9.2% of the centers had less than 25% of the clinical practice affected, 46.1% had 26%-50% of their activity reduced, 35.5% had a 51%-75% reduction, and 9.2% had more than 75% of their surgical work cancelled or postponed. Sixty-three percent affirmed that patients had been tested for COVID-19 before surgery. Regarding the impact of the COVID-19 pandemic on the mental health of those interviewed, 3.9% reported fear and anxiety with panic episodes, 7.9% had worsening of previous anxiety symptoms, 60.5% reported occasional fear, 10.5% had sadness and some depressive symptoms, and 2.6% reported depressive symptoms. CONCLUSIONS: The COVID-19 pandemic has posed unprecedented challenges to healthcare services worldwide, including neurosurgical units. Medical workers, pediatric neurosurgeons included, should be aware of safety measures and follow the recommendations of local healthcare organizations, preventing and controlling the disease. Attention should be given to the psychological burden of exposure to SARS-CoV-2 in healthcare workers, which carries a high risk of anxiety and depression.

INTRODUCTION/BACKGROUND: Distraction osteogenesis (DO) with an external distraction device such as the rigid external distraction frame has become an established method for treating midface hypoplasia in faciocraniosynostosis. It allows for greater advancement of the midface in comparison with traditional Le Fort III osteotomies, associated or not with fronto-orbital osteotomies (Le Fort IV). However, the forward movement of the bone segments may not always be performed obeying an ideal distraction vector, resulting in asymmetries, anterior open bite, and loosening of screws. In addition, the cost of the distraction devices is significant and may preclude their routine use in developing countries. METHOD: We present an alternative device and method for craniofacial advancement in a clinical case of Crouzon's syndrome. RESULTS: A 3D virtual simulation of the distraction vector and a modified external device were used in the current case. CONCLUSION: The alternative external device in this case proved to be safe, effective, and reliable.

OBJECTIVE: The effectiveness of decompressive craniectomy (DC) in the context of neurocritical care in adult patients has been recently under debate. The aim of our study was to evaluate the impact of decompressive craniectomy in severe traumatic brain injury (TBI) in children, focusing on short and long-term neurological and neuropsychological outcomes. METHODS: Retrospective review of the medical records of children admitted at a level I trauma center, between January 2012 and December 2015, submitted to DC due to severe TBI. Additionally, an extensive review of literature on this subject was carried out. RESULTS: Sixteen patients underwent DC for TBI at our institution during the evaluated period. 62.5% were males and the mean age was 12 years. Road traffic accident (RTA) was the main mechanism of trauma (62.5%). Average Glasgow Coma Scale (GCS) at admission was 5.2, whereas 75% of the patients presented with pathological pupillary reaction. Initial computed tomography (CT) showed skull fractures in 62.5% and acute subdural hemorrhage (ASH) in 56.3% of the patients. The mean intracranial pressure (ICP) was 27.2 mmHg prior to surgery, and the mean time window between admission and DC was 36.3 h. Unilateral DC was performed in 68.8% of the cases. The average Glasgow Outcome Scale (GOS) at 6-month follow-up was 3.7, whereas 70% of the survivors presented good recovery (GOS 4-5). Abnormal pupillary reaction at hospital admission increased 3-fold the risk of long-term neuropsychological disturbances. Follow-up evaluation revealed cognitive abnormality in 55.6% of the patients. The overall mortality at 6-month follow-up was 37.5%. CONCLUSION: The present study indicates towards a potential benefit of DC in children with severe TBI; nevertheless, our data demonstrated a high incidence of neuropsychological impairment in the long-term follow-up. Psychological and cognitive assessment should be computed in prognosis evaluation in future prospective studies.

BACKGROUND: Primary idiopathic intracranial hypertension (PIIH) in children is rare and has a poorly understood pathophysiology. It is characterized by raised intracranial pressure (ICP) in the absence of an identified brain lesion. Diagnosis is usually confirmed by the measurement of a high cerebrospinal fluid (CSF) opening pressure and exclusion of secondary causes of intracranial hypertension. Refractory PIIH may lead to severe visual impairment. The purpose of this study was to evaluate a cranial morcellation decompression (CMD) technique as a new surgical alternative to stabilize intracranial pressure in PIIH. MATERIALS AND METHODS: A literature review was carried out, disclosing only 7 pediatric cases of PIIH treated with surgical skull expansion. In addition, we describe here one case of our own experience treated by CMD. CONCLUSIONS: CMD surgery is a safe and effective option to control refractory PIIH in selected patients.

BACKGROUND: Hypertrophic olivary degeneration (HOD) is a rare transsynaptic form of degeneration occurring after injury to the dentato-rubro-olivary pathway ("Guillain-Mollaret triangle"). The majority of studies have described HOD resulting from posterior fossa (PF) hemorrhage or infarction. HOD in patients undergoing PF surgery has not been well characterized. These lesions are rare and symptomatic children with HOD are even more uncommon. The purpose of this study was to evaluate HOD that develops after PF operations in children. MATERIALS AND METHODS: A literature review was carried out describing 37 pediatric cases of HOD in 13 articles. In addition, two new cases of our own experience were included. CONCLUSIONS: HOD is a rare complication related after PF tumors surgery and symptoms may be misdiagnosed with pediatric cerebellar mutism syndrome. Children with HOD usually do not develop palatal tremor but ataxia is common.
